In an era of tightening margins, businesses are turning to outsourced accounting to streamline operations and cut costs. This case study examines how GreenLeaf Innovations, a sustainable packaging company with $5M in annual revenue, reduced its accounting expenses by 50% while improving accuracy and scalability.
The Challenge: Rising Costs and Inefficiencies
Before outsourcing, GreenLeaf managed accounting in-house with a team of three:
- Monthly Costs: $12,000 (salaries, benefits, software licenses).
- Pain Points:
- Time-consuming manual data entry (20+ hours monthly).
- Frequent errors in payroll processing, leading to employee disputes.
- Limited capacity for financial forecasting during rapid growth.
A 2022 internal audit revealed that 15% of invoices had discrepancies, costing the company $45,000 annually in reprocessing fees and missed vendor discounts.
The Solution: Partnering with Experts
GreenLeaf partnered with BrinkForge, a financial consultancy specializing in SME accounting, to overhaul its processes. The strategy included:
1. Transitioning to Cloud-Based Systems
BrinkForge migrated GreenLeaf to automated platforms like QuickBooks Online and integrated Estellarz, their technology partner, for AI-driven expense tracking and real-time reporting. This eliminated manual data entry and reduced errors by 80%.
2. Scalable Service Model
Instead of a fixed in-house team, GreenLeaf adopted BrinkForge’s tiered pricing:
- Basic Tier: Bookkeeping, payroll, and AP/AR management ($3,500/month).
- Premium Add-Ons: Financial forecasting and tax optimization ($1,500/month).
3. Compliance Automation
Estellarz’s tools automated sales tax filings and payroll compliance, ensuring adherence to multi-state regulations.
